现有如下数据:
A:B,C,D,F,E,O
B:A,C,E,K
C:F,A,D,I
D:A,E,F,L
E:B,C,D,M,L
F:A,B,C,D,E,O,M
G:A,C,D,E,F
H:A,C,D,E,O
I:A,O
J:B,O
K:A,C,D
L:D,E,F
M:E,F,G
O:A,H,I,J
求哪些人两两之间有共同好友,及共同好友有哪些人?
思路:
第一步:只求哪些人两两之间有某个共同好友
A:B,C,D,F,E,O
for(好友列表){
context.write(“好友”,“用户”);
}
A-B C
A-B E
A-C F
…
package com.bigdata.map
1